Pin it A festive and fun dessert dip this platter features a creamy marshmallow dip rolled in coconut snowballs perfect for kids parties and holiday gatherings.

Ingredients
- Marshmallow Dip: 200 g cream cheese softened, 120 g marshmallow fluff, 100 ml heavy cream, 1 tsp vanilla extract
- Snowball Coating: 60 g desiccated coconut
- Dippers: 8 large strawberries hulled, 1 banana sliced into thick rounds, 8 apple wedges, 12 mini pretzels, 8 digestive biscuits halved, 8 large marshmallows
Instructions
- Step 1:
- In a medium m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ese until smooth.
- Step 2:
- Add marshmallow fluff and vanilla extract, and beat until well combined.
- Step 3:
- Whip the heavy cream in a separate bowl until soft peaks form, then fold it gently into the marshmallow mixture.
- Step 4:
- Using a spoon or a small ice cream scoop, form the dip into 8 round balls.
- Step 5:
- Roll each ball in desiccated coconut to coat them evenly, creating a snowball effect.
- Step 6:
- Arrange the marshmallow snowballs on a large platter.
- Step 7:
- Surround with prepared dippers strawberries, banana rounds, apple wedges, pretzels, biscuits, and marshmallows.
- Step 8:
- Serve immediately, or chill for up to 2 hours before serving.

Required Tools
Mixing bowls, Hand mixer or whisk, Ice cream scoop or spoon, Large platter
Allergen Information
Contains dairy (cream cheese, heavy cream), Contains gluten (biscuits, pretzels), May contain nuts if included in biscuits or pretzels, Contains sulfites if using certain dried coconut, Always check ingredient labels for hidden allergens
Nutritional Information
Calories 220, Total Fat 10 g, Carbohydrates 29 g, Protein 3 g (per serving)

Recipe FAQ
- → What dairy ingredients are used in this dish?
Cream cheese and heavy cream provide a rich, creamy base for the marshmallow mixture.
- → How is the snowball coating made?
The marshmallow balls are rolled in desiccated coconut to create a snowball-like appearance and add a subtle texture.
- → Can the dippers be substituted?
Yes, you can swap the suggested fruits and snacks with alternatives like grapes or pineapple for variety.

- → How long can the platter be chilled before serving?
The completed platter can be chilled for up to 2 hours to keep the snowballs firm and refreshing.
- → Are there any allergen considerations?
This dish contains dairy and gluten; check dippers for nuts or sulfites if sensitive.
